The Best Gluten Free Cake Recipe list


Certainly! Here’s a list of delicious gluten-free cake recipes for you to enjoy. (easy gluten-free cake recipes)

  1. Flourless Chocolate Cake: A rich and decadent chocolate cake made with almond flour or ground nuts for a dense and fudgy texture.
  2. Lemon Almond Cake: A light and tangy cake made with almond flour and fresh lemon zest, perfect for a refreshing dessert.
  3. Vanilla Bean Coconut Flour Cake: A moist and fluffy cake made with coconut flour and infused with the flavors of vanilla bean for a delicate sweetness.
  4. Orange Olive Oil Cake: A Mediterranean-inspired cake made with almond flour, olive oil, and fresh orange juice for a unique and flavorful dessert.
  5. Gluten-Free Carrot Cake: A classic carrot cake made with gluten-free flour, grated carrots, warm spices, and creamy dairy-free frosting.
  6. Banana Walnut Cake: A moist and flavorful cake made with ripe bananas, chopped walnuts, and gluten-free flour for a delicious twist on a traditional favorite.
  7. Coconut Flour Pound Cake: A dense and buttery pound cake made with coconut flour and sweetened with honey or maple syrup for a delightful treat.
  8. Raspberry Almond Cake: A delicate almond cake studded with fresh raspberries and topped with sliced almonds for a burst of flavor and texture.
  9. Flourless Lemon Blueberry Cake: A light and airy cake made with almond flour, fresh lemon zest, and juicy blueberries for a refreshing summertime dessert.
  10. Chocolate Zucchini Cake: A moist and chocolaty cake made with shredded zucchini and cocoa powder, perfect for sneaking in some extra veggies.

Celebrate in Style: Delicious Gluten Free Birthday Cake Recipe,

Every birthday deserves a special cake, and for those with gluten sensitivities or dietary restrictions, finding the perfect gluten-free option can be a challenge. Fear not! This gluten-free birthday cake recipe is here to save the day. Moist, flavorful, and utterly delicious, this cake is sure to be the star of any birthday celebration. Let’s dive into the recipe and get ready to celebrate in style!

Ingredients:

For the Cake:

  • 2 cups gluten-free all-purpose flour blend
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/2 cup unsweetened applesauce
  • 1/2 cup vegetable oil
  • 3 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up buttermilk (or dairy-free alternative)

For the Frosting:

  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ter (or dairy-free alternative), softened
  • 2 cups confectioners’ sugar
  • 2-3 tablespoons milk (or dairy-free alternative)
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our two 9-inch round cake pans, or line them with parchment paper for easy removal.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, combine the gluten-free flour blend,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Mix well to combine.
  3. In a separate bowl, whisk together the applesauce, vegetable oil, eggs, and vanilla extract until smooth.
  4. Gradually add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ients, mixing until just combined. Be careful not to overmix.
  5. Stir in the buttermilk until the batter is smooth and well combined.
  6. Divide the batter evenly between the prepared cake pans and smooth the tops with a spatula.
  7.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center of the cakes comes out clean.
  8. Remove the cakes from the oven and allow them to cool in the pans for 10 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.
  9. While the cakes are cooling, prepare the frosting. In a mixing bowl, beat the softened butter until creamy. Gradually add the confectioners’ sugar, milk, and vanilla extract, beating until smooth and fluffy.
  10. Once the cakes have cooled completely, frost the top of one cake layer with a generous amount of frosting. Place the second cake layer on top and frost the top and sides of the cake with the remaining frosting.
  11. Decorate the cake as desired with sprinkles, candles, or fresh fruit.
  12. Slice, serve, and enjoy your delicious gluten-free birthday cake!

What is the difference between gluten free cake recipe and regular cake recipe ?

With gluten-free baking, we use a combination of gluten-free flours, starches, and a binder (like xanthan gum). These ingredients take longer to set than regular gluten-containing flour, meaning they may remain slightly “gummy” or sticky until they have cooled
